Assuming you're going for decent image quality shots...
unless you're willing to go for those high-end gopro hero 11 or the latest dji action 4, most action cams come with extremely small sensors.. in fact, way smaller than most mid-range to flagship phones. most midrangers have pretty decent main camera at least 1/1.7 or above sensor size. The action cams not mentioned above still come with <1/2 sensor sizes which is terrible for low light/underwater. If your footage is mainly outdoors, bright lights, then action cams are pretty good for these use cases. maybe buying a nice underwater housing for your phone might be an option also. Happy hunting |
